Tennis at Georgia Southwestern State University typically offers a mix of athletic and academic aid depending on division (ncaa_d2). Full rides are rare — partial scholarships and academic stacking are more common.
Most sports begin serious recruiting 12–24 months before enrollment. Register with the NCAA Eligibility Center early for D1/D2 paths.
